[fusion-commits] Compizconfig Settings Manager in Python: Changes to 'master' (40e90671ab5059b2b1802af11ce5605264cb2e38)

guillaume at server.beryl-project.org guillaume at server.beryl-project.org
Fri Aug 3 19:13:25 CEST 2007


New commits:
commit 40e90671ab5059b2b1802af11ce5605264cb2e38
Author: Guillaume Seguin <guillaume at segu.in>
Date:   Fri Aug 3 19:13:21 2007 +0200

    * Attempt to not request build before install


 setup.py |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)


Modified: fusion/compizconfig/ccsm/setup.py
===================================================================
--- fusion/compizconfig/ccsm/setup.py
+++ fusion/compizconfig/ccsm/setup.py
@@ -125,7 +125,9 @@ if os.path.isdir (podir):
     for name in os.listdir (podir):
         if name[-2:] == "po":
             name = name[:-3]
-            if sys.argv[1] == "build":
+            if sys.argv[1] == "build" \
+               or (sys.argv[1] == "install" and \
+                   not os.path.exists (mopath % name)):
                 if not os.path.isdir ("build/locale/" + name):
                     os.makedirs ("build/locale/" + name)
                 os.system (buildcmd % (name, name))


More information about the commits mailing list